Glen Nevis Cottage is a detached cottage near Clovenstone, just outside Inverurie. It's on its own, with about 11 acres of land around it. You can walk around the fields. The garden is enclosed and there's a patio area to sit out.
It sleeps three people. There are two bedrooms and one wet room with a walk-in shower. It's got a 3 Star rating, so it's comfortable and clean. There's a woodburning stove in the living room. You can bring up to two dogs.
Inverurie is about five minutes away by car. It's a market town with supermarkets, a few shops, pubs, and places to eat. Everything you'd need is there.
The area is good for golf, with courses nearby. The coast is about half an hour's drive. Stonehaven, with Dunnottar Castle, is worth a visit. Aberdeen city centre is roughly 25 minutes away. It has museums, the beach, and the harbour if you want to try dolphin spotting.

At the cottage, bedding and towels are included. There's a washing machine, WiFi, a TV, and parking. The kitchen has what you need for cooking.
